Researchers at UC San Francisco have developed a “digital biomarker” that would use a smartphone’s built-in camera to detect diabetes – one of the world’s top causes of disease and death – potentially providing a low-cost, in-home alternative to blood draws and clinic-based screening tools. Detection of biomarkers relies on determining changes in optical, mechanical, electrical, or electrochemical properties. Detection of analytes in biofluids is typically based on immunoprecipitation. Biorecognition elements (BREs) (Figure 2a.1-2) are used to recognize the analytes.
